Infantile tremor syndrome (ITS) is a self-limiting clinical condition primarily affecting infants. It is characterised by a constellation of symptoms, including coarse tremors, often exacerbated by wakefulness and mitigated during sleep, anaemia, distinctive skin pigmentation changes, developmental regression and hypotonia in seemingly well-nourished infants. While a definitive aetiology remains elusive, various hypotheses have been proposed, including infectious, metabolic and nutritional factors. A growing body of evidence implicates Vitamin B12 deficiency as a significant contributor to ITS pathogenesis, though this association remains a subject of ongoing debate. In the absence of a conclusive diagnosis, empirical management often involves a multifaceted approach. Nutritional supplementation with iron, calcium, magnesium, Vitamin B12 and other essential micronutrients is a cornerstone of treatment. Pharmacotherapy, primarily with propranolol, may be employed to alleviate tremors, though other anticonvulsants such as phenobarbital, phenytoin and carbamazepine may be considered in refractory cases.
